Tesla Accuses IG Metall Member of Secretly Recording Giga Berlin Meeting

Tesla has accused an IG Metall member of secretly recording a works council meeting at its Giga Berlin plant, an allegation the union has denied. The incident occurred on February 10, 2026, when police seized the computer of an IG Metall member at the Giga Berlin site. Tesla's plant manager, André Thierig, described the event as 'truly beyond words', stating that an external union representative recorded the internal meeting without permission. The union has denied Tesla's claims, arguing that the representative did not record the meeting and that Tesla's accusation is a tactic ahead of upcoming works council elections.

The next works council election at Giga Berlin is scheduled for March 2-4, 2026, with approximately 11,000 employees eligible to vote. The previous election took place in 2024 due to a significant increase in the workforce size, as required by German labor law.

In other news, SpaceX has secured a legal victory after the National Labor Relations Board (NLRB) dismissed a case accusing the company of terminating engineers involved in an open letter against Elon Musk. The NLRB confirmed it no longer has jurisdiction over SpaceX, which was previously under the jurisdiction of the National Mediation Board (NMB).

Finally, SpaceX has taken steps to block unauthorized use of its Starlink satellite internet network, a move that has disrupted Russian military communications. Ukrainian officials confirmed that Starlink terminals believed to be used by Russian troops were disabled after coordination with SpaceX, affecting frontline communications and drone operations.
